Output 37876309e75b1783e88654f3d9602ba6a2ff6425f21b74df621965e9acffb7d9:10

value
870000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2af403c20c3f8900553df1ba35a2eafd99e7d84e OP_EQUALVERIFY OP_CHECKSIG
address
14v7hVezkHz5kboUmwwmidiBrLVtBt9Ak2
transaction
37876309e75b1783e88654f3d9602ba6a2ff6425f21b74df621965e9acffb7d9
spent
true